Разработка задач на Прологе, Лиспе
Изучение основных возможностей и базовых понятий языка Пролог и Лисп. Характеристика принципов построения программ на языке функционального и логического программирования. Реализация определенной структуры данных и рекурсивной программы вычисления.
Подобные документы
Определение программы циклической структуры. Характеристика основных видов циклов. Рассмотрение структуры программы на высоком языке программирования Pascal. Формирование, хранение и функционирование массивов данных. Введение счетчика в программу.
курсовая работа, добавлен 27.02.2020Разработка программы, основанной на идее наследования классов, основные принципы объектно-ориентированного программирования. Реализация наследования посредством написания программы на языке С++. Разработка программы с использованием абстрактного класса.
отчет по практике, добавлен 18.02.2019Рассмотрение языка программирования общего назначения. Характеристика системного программирования как области его применения. Исследование особенностей составления программ С++ для вычисления различного рода задач. Определение основных блок-схем.
задача, добавлен 21.04.2015Языки программирования и их разнообразие, диалекты, реализации и версии. Машинные коды, ассемблер - "сборщик", автокод. Фортран, лисп, кобол, алгол 60, бэйсик. Создание многоцелевого языка программирования. APL, лого, паскаль, пролог, си, ада, форт, java.
презентация, добавлен 04.05.2012Введение в систему логического программирования Turbo Prolog. Способы решения рекурсивных задач с помощью языка пролог. Продукционное представление знаний. Применение динамической базы данных. Анализ сведений с помощью фреймов и семантических сетей.
методичка, добавлен 21.07.2017Понятие C++ как компилируемого статического типизированного языка программирования общего назначения. Анализ функций и возможностей. Алгоритм разработки программы, требования к ней. Описание используемых функций, модулей, инструкция пользователя.
курсовая работа, добавлен 30.05.2014Обзор функциональных особенностей и возможностей языка программирования Delphi. Создание приложения позволяющего создать базу данных, делать ее сортировку, производить новые записи или удаление полей. Создание алиасов к базе данных. Листинг программы.
контрольная работа, добавлен 26.05.2012Изучение структуры языка программирования баз данных SQL - мощного полнофункционального сервера баз данных, отличающегося высокой производительностью, быстротой освоения и удобным интерфейсом администрирования. Классификация типов данных в языке SQL.
контрольная работа, добавлен 19.11.2009Классификация языков программирования. Размещение данных и программ в памяти ПЭВМ. Понятие алгоритма и способы его записи. Синтаксис языка Cи и базовые типы объектов. Рассмотрение констант вещественного типа. Характеристика базовых инструкций языка С.
курс лекций, добавлен 18.01.2014Определение сущности рекурсивной функции в языке Си. Представление данных с плавающей точкой. Вычисление сумм и произведений данных с плавающей точкой. Изучение порядка выполнения арифметических операций в выражениях. Анализ плавающих типов языка Си.
лекция, добавлен 24.07.2014Оператор присваивания, вывод информации на экран. Оператор Pascal, элементы языка программирования, задающие описание действия, которое необходимо выполнить компьютеру. Составление программы с использованием оператора для вычисления значения функции.
презентация, добавлен 15.12.2019Рассмотрение принципов разработки программы для определения площади геометрической фигуры. Описание метода решения и алгоритма программы. Определение функционального назначения. Описание логической структуры. Характеристика входных и выходных данных.
курсовая работа, добавлен 22.02.2019Анализ программы с использованием принципов объектно-ориентированного программирования на языке высокого уровня С#. Реализация основного класса программы. Суть произвольного заполнения массива числами. Сохранение в текстовый файл результатов сортировки.
курсовая работа, добавлен 25.11.2015Общая характеристика правил оформления лабораторных работ по информатике. Рассмотрение основных способов написания программ на языке СИ, знакомство с основными проблемами. Особенности программы на языке СИ. Анализ программ вычисления по заданной формуле.
курсовая работа, добавлен 11.12.2013Приобретение навыков программирования разветвляющихся алгоритмов. Освоение операторов if и switch языка C++, позволяющих реализовывать разветвляющиеся алгоритмы. Формат условного оператора в языке C++. Составление программы для вычисления функции.
лабораторная работа, добавлен 30.04.2024Исторические аспекты развития программирования. Классификация и обзор языков программирования. Характерные черты процедурного, функционального, логического, объектно-ориентированного программирования. Рассмотрение языков программирования баз данных.
курсовая работа, добавлен 21.08.2017Представление данных семантической сети на языке фактов пролога. Реализация наследования в семантических сетях. Фрейм как структура данных, компоненты которой называются слотами. Процедура вычисления относительного размера. Модификация процедуры value.
лекция, добавлен 17.10.2013Разработка программы игры с использованием принципов объектно-ориентированного программирования. Реализация графических объектов и их перемещение по траекториям. Создание управляемого объекта. Иерархия объектов, блок-схема основной части программы.
курсовая работа, добавлен 24.02.2015Принципы построения линейных алгоритмов и простых расчетных программ на языке программирования C. Принципы создание консольных приложений в среде Microsoft Visual Studio. Разработка программы по преобразованию градусов Фаренгейта в градусы Цельсия.
лабораторная работа, добавлен 17.10.2012Турбо-Пролог - компиляторно-ориентированный язык программирования высокого уровня. Теоретические сведения о программе. Отладка, модификация и структурная схема программы. Описание предикатов, текст и тестирование программы, руководство пользователя.
курсовая работа, добавлен 18.02.2012Методические рекомендации по решению практических задач автоматизации вычислительных процессов с использованием языка программирования Turbo Pascal в части работы с массивами данных, построения таблиц идентификаторов и алгоритмов, разработки программ.
методичка, добавлен 18.10.2017Математические и алгоритмические основы решения задачи. Формула Тейлора для некоторых элементарных функций. Функциональные модели решения задачи и их программная реализация. Понятие элементарной функции. Пример выполнения программы для вычисления.
курсовая работа, добавлен 20.01.2010Понятия алгоритмизации, языка программирования, алфавита, семантики. Структура программы на языке С. Сложные типы данных, арифметика указателей. Функциональная схема программы. Динамические структуры данных. Иерархическая структура потоковых классов.
шпаргалка, добавлен 22.11.2013Описание распространенных реализаций данного языка. Основные типы данных и операторов. Характеристика примеров с часто применяемыми алгоритмами и фундаментальными структурами данных. Задачи для отработки основных приемов программирования на языке Си.
учебное пособие, добавлен 11.10.2014Составление локальной и сетевой программы вычисления стоимости акций, особенности файловой системы и построения алгоритма решения задач. Характеристика языков программирования JavaScript и Borland Delphi. Расчеты с помощью табличного оператора Excel.
курсовая работа, добавлен 21.01.2015